**Overview**

The Business Systems Analyst (BSA) at URBN Inc. plays a pivotal role in the Solution Delivery group, supporting the development and delivery of omnichannel ecommerce products. Working closely with Solution Delivery Team Leads, the BSA collaborates with various teams to optimize URBN’s core web, mobile and platform services, ensuring software quality, scalability, and completeness.

**Responsibilities**
- Support 1-2 Scrum teams in technical solution design, grooming activities, and development as a Technical Product Owner in partnership with Platform Services/Web/Mobile System Analysts, Product Managers, Engineering Tech Leads and Architects.
- Act as a liaison between URBN’s IT Organization and Engineering Group and multiple groups within the Digital Product Organization, including Product Management and User Experience Design.
- Support the coordination of cross-team dependencies by understanding the incremental deliveries of downstream systems and how those dependencies affect the ability of the engineering teams to complete work.
- Prioritize incoming inquiries, research issues across multiple functions and systems, perform root cause analysis, and recommend solutions to resolve low to moderate complexity issues.
- Assess potential risk against delivery effort when evaluating business requirements and negotiating priorities with business partners.
- Ensure the quality of and help maintain the URBN product backlog through Atlassian’s JIRA issue and project tracking tool in partnership with digital product managers and Engineering leads.
- Steward the quality of URBN system architecture by advocating allocation towards technical debt, code clean-up, and test coverage during intermittent periods between feature releases.

**Qualifications**
- 3+ years of experience in IT/digital technology environment, with expertise in program/project management, data/system analysis, and technical requirements definition.
- Well-rounded experience delivering integrated software solutions over complex system architecture and dependencies spanning multiple teams.
- Adequate understanding of RESTful services, including experience with planning, integration, and delivery. Exposure to Python programming language is advantageous.

**Job Skills**
- Self-motivated with a desire to seek answers to questions and solutions to problems independently.
- Effective communication skills, coordinating across teams in a streamlined manner.
- Ability to bridge consensus within an interdisciplinary team to ensure key decisions are made timely.

**Education**

Bachelor’s Degree in Information Technology, Computer Science, or equivalent experience.
